For the past 10 hours I farmed level 30 elites in hillbrad. The item I was hunting for was the legendary Humberts Helm. Although green in quality, the rarity and uniqueness of helm makes it desirable among the community with adventurers willing to pay a hefty price to get their hands on their very own Pre BIS humbert’s helm.
Little did I know, that embarking on this journey would yield me more expensive items that I can count. Started the grind with 25 gold and a bit of streamer luck because in the first hour managed to obtain a spectral necklace of the monkey which believe it or not sold for 100 Gold. Not long after I got 2 humbert Helms back to back, I was already sold on the spot and commited to finish the entire 10 hours to see it’s entire potential.
Now let me tell you where we are and why we are here. Dun Garok is a dwarven keep situated into the southeastern hills of Hillsbrad Foothills. Led by Captain Ironhill, the dwarves helped protect the humans of Hillsbrad as well as the Azurelode Mine. 3 Types of mobs can be found here: Priests, mountaneers and Rifemens. Our focus will be on the Rifemens as they are the ones that drop Humberts with about 4% chance, wowhead has a pretty decent sample size with 410 drops out of 10400 kills. Nevertheless, I recommend clearing all mobs around since some of them share the same respawn spot, meaning that you will have to clear mountaners to make Riflemen spawn. Don’t worry to much about this, all the mobs here have a slight chance of droping some of the most expensive BOEs for lvl 25 cap, Such as thunderbrow ring, troll’s bane leggind and many more.
As you know by now this is horde grind only, however the helm can be aquired by allience via the booty bay auction house. I even sold one there for about 75 gold, the only difference is that taxes are double on the neutral auction house.
Since we’re fighting lvl 30 elites, this grind is recommended for hunters mostly. But during my 10 hour gring I saw some arcane mages, feral druid and shamans doing a fair job. If your class does not qualify for this grind don’t be shy, duo farming is quite popular here.
No matter what class or party combo you play, you must Isolate mobs and clear them 1 by 1. Some mobs are in packs of 3 and knowing how to split pull will make a huge difference. Split pulling is a little more complex but simply put it: get a dinamite, if not an engineer get an EZ trow dinamite and pull the mobs by trowing and hitting all the mobs at the same time. Start running while trying to keep the mobs at max range, after 5 seconds select the mob you desire to clear and hit him with an instant spell. After another 5 seconds the other mobs will unleash, leaving you with 1 single target.
I tried to list most of the items found here on the auction house and alot of them sold for a decent price. If the items expired I tried to list them slightly cheaper for 2 more times. If after 3 listings items didn’t sell, I simply vendored them. There is a really nice feeling logging into the game to a full mailbox of sold items. Collecting hundreds of gold everyday for you previous day of grind. Season of discovery is a blast and I found myself having fun once again doing the mundane tasks such as farming gold.
In terms of consistency the first 4 hours gave me 4 Humbert Helms and couple of rare items but the next 6 hours dropped none, managed to get in the last hour 2 more helms for a total of 6. This is still an RNG based spot which makes it a bit of a gamble if you want to grind it for short amount of time. However if you’re looking for consistency, eventually the RNG will even out on the long term. The grind yielding an average of 40 to 70 gold/ hour depending on the prices of the server that you play. I started this grind at hour 1 with 25 gold to my name and ended at 10 hour mark with 525 gold. A total of 500 gold was made which puts somewhere on the 50 gold/hour mark.
